Assessing Your Home's Solar Potential
Before diving right into solar panel installation, you should analyze your home's solar capacity. Begin by checking your roof covering's positioning and incline; south-facing roofing systems normally record one of the most sunshine.
Seek any kind of blockages, like trees or high structures, that could cast shadows on your panels. These can significantly reduce power manufacturing. Consider your neighborhood environment as well; sunny locations generate better outcomes than regularly over cast regions.
Next off, examine your energy needs and usage patterns to identify the amount of panels you'll need. You might additionally intend to use on the internet solar calculators or speak with an expert to obtain a more clear image.

Zoning Laws Conformity
When taking into consideration solar panel installation, comprehending zoning regulations and regional guidelines is essential to making sure a smooth procedure.
Before making any type of decisions, you must get in touch with your city government or zoning office to find out any type of constraints that may apply to your residential property. These regulations can determine where you can put your solar panels, just how high they can be, and whether you need extra approvals.
Be aware that some communities or home owners' associations might have their very own regulations relating to solar power systems. By acquainting on your own with these guidelines ahead of time, you can prevent prospective penalties or costly alterations later on.
Ultimately, abiding by zoning laws establishes a solid structure for your solar project, guaranteeing it lines up with neighborhood criteria.
License Application Process
Navigating the authorization application process is a crucial action after guaranteeing conformity with zoning regulations.
You'll need to examine your regional laws to establish what licenses are needed for solar panel installment. This commonly includes building authorizations, electric licenses, and possibly also unique licenses relying on your area.
Don't neglect to gather essential files like website plans and specs for the solar equipment.
As soon as you have actually filled in the needed forms, send your application to your regional authority.
Be planned for possible examinations, as officials might want to validate compliance with safety and building regulations.
It's additionally important to stay in touch with your local workplace during this process to attend to any kind of questions or concerns they may have.
Examining Your Energy Requirements and Intake
Just how can you identify the appropriate solar panel system for your home? Beginning by reviewing your energy needs and usage.
Take a look at your energy costs over the past year to comprehend your average regular monthly use. This'll provide you a baseline for just how much energy you require to generate. Don't neglect to take into consideration seasonal variations; your power requires could surge in summer or winter season.
Next, think of any type of future changes, like adding appliances or electrical vehicles, which might increase your usage.
Exploring Financial Incentives and Tax Obligation Credit Scores
Before you devote to setting up solar panels, it's vital to explore the economic incentives and tax credit histories offered to you. Federal and state governments usually provide significant tax debts to counter setup expenses.
For example, the government solar tax credit history can cover a percent of your expenses, enabling you to conserve thousands. Additionally, numerous states supply discounts or gives to encourage solar adoption, which can even more lower your initial investment.
Energy business might likewise have reward programs that compensate you for creating solar power. Research these options completely and talk to a tax obligation specialist to optimize your financial savings.

Setup Type Choices
Choosing the ideal installation type for solar panels can considerably impact your system's efficiency and performance. You'll typically experience two major choices: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.
Roof-mounted panels are commonly the best choice for property owners, as they utilize existing area and can be less costly to mount. Nevertheless, if your roofing system isn't appropriate-- possibly as a result of shading or architectural concerns-- ground-mounted systems may be the far better option.
They allow for ideal positioning, optimizing sunshine exposure. In addition, you can readjust their angle to enhance performance.
Before choosing, consider factors like offered space, budget plan, and neighborhood guidelines. By evaluating these choices thoroughly, you'll ensure your solar panel installment satisfies your power requires effectively.
Aesthetic Factors to consider
While functionality is essential, appearances should not be neglected when choosing solar panels for your home. You want panels that not only work efficiently however also enhance your home's design.
Think about the color and size of the solar panels; black panels frequently mix seamlessly with dark roof coverings, while blue panels may stand out much more. Consider alternatives like building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V) that replace typical roofing materials, offering a streamlined look.
You could also discover solar tiles, which mimic typical roof covering and can boost curb allure. Do not forget to analyze the format and placement of the panels to optimize both performance and visual harmony.
Inevitably, striking the appropriate balance in between efficiency and aesthetic appeals will make your solar investment a lot more gratifying.

Researching Respectable Solar Installers
Just how do you discover a credible solar installer? Beginning by asking pals, family, or next-door neighbors for referrals. Their firsthand experiences can guide you to reliable alternatives.
Next, inspect online evaluations and ratings on systems like Google and Yelp to evaluate client satisfaction. Try to find installers with a solid performance history and industry certifications, as this indicates expertise and experience.
Don't wait to request quotes from several firms to compare prices and solutions.
Lastly, verify their warranty offerings and after-sales support-- these elements can make a considerable distinction in your long-term satisfaction.
Planning for Upkeep and Long-lasting Performance
Selecting a trustworthy solar installer establishes the foundation for your solar panel system, but preparing for maintenance and long-term efficiency is equally as crucial.
Normal maintenance can prolong the life of your solar panels and ensure they run at peak performance. Think about scheduling annual evaluations to check for particles, damage, or put on.
Likewise, acquaint on your own with the guarantee and service contracts; understanding what's covered can conserve you cash down the line. Keep an eye on your power production, as a sudden decline may suggest a problem.
Lastly, remain notified about technological developments; upgrading parts can boost performance and effectiveness, ultimately optimizing your investment in solar power.
